i have already put a super hot 53 in the T-34. 10x7 at 17,100 on the ground and only 17,500 in the air. the pipe is holding it back in the air. anyway the T-34 has so much drag that i only picked up 10-13 mph with more powerfull engine. i dont race with that engine we just wanted to see if the T-34 will handle all the power and still do pylon turns.
